Abstract
A touch system including an optical touch panel and a touch pen, and a method of controlling an interference optical signal in the touch system. The optical touch panel device includes: a pattern analyzer detecting a pattern of an optical signal by scanning an optical touch panel, and comparing a detected pattern with patterns designated to button functions of a touch pen; a touch location detector recognizing a detected location of the optical signal as a touch location, if the detected pattern corresponds to a first pattern designated to a button function; an interference controller determining the optical signal as an interference signal, if a detected region of the optical signal exceeds a critical range; and a wireless transmitter outputting a control signal to the touch pen so that the touch pen may change the first pattern designated to the button function to a second pattern.

6. A touch pen comprising:
-
a wireless receiver configured to receive a control signal from an optical touch panel requesting change of a first pattern, which corresponds to a pattern of an optical signal that is determined as an interference signal in an optical touch panel, designated to a button function to a second pattern; a pattern generator configured to change the first pattern designated to the button function to the second pattern according to the control signal; and a light-emitting device configured to generate an optical signal corresponding to the second pattern so that the optical touch panel performs the button function. - View Dependent Claims (7, 8, 9, 10)

16. A method of controlling an interference optical signal in a touch pen, the method comprising:
-
wirelessly receiving a control signal requesting a change of a first pattern, which corresponds to a pattern of an optical signal that is determined as an interference signal in an optical touch panel, designated to a button function to a second pattern from the optical touch panel; changing the first pattern designated to the button function to the second pattern according to the control signal; and generating an optical signal corresponding to the second pattern so that the optical touch panel performs the button function. - View Dependent Claims (17, 18, 19, 20)
